Elizabeth Beckers Strobel is a lawyer practicing domestic relations law, family law, juvenile law and 2 other areas of law. Elizabeth received a B.A. degree from Montana State University in 1974, and has been licensed for 48 years. Elizabeth practices in Greeley, CO.

Questions to ask a child custody attorney in Greeley, Colorado
A short list to run through before you commit: How many child custody matters have you handled in the last year? What's your fee structure? Who else in the office will work on this? What's your realistic estimate of timeline and range of outcomes? How do I reach you between meetings?
